Output 1621b71460c3e724c2adc60a398556de9e71cdbeb6e99ec8f3a4677074e40106:30

value
310376308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ee2620c3a45c62458d0d708ffb320efe1db7104 OP_EQUAL
address
3GB7tDgcsc1sn11Mpaw4rkTQptacLDnkcK
transaction
1621b71460c3e724c2adc60a398556de9e71cdbeb6e99ec8f3a4677074e40106
spent
true